Analysis
The most recent figure for meat of camels, fresh or chilled (indigenous) — gross production value in Asia is 810,155 1000 Int$, measured in 2024. That is the highest value across all 64 years on record.
The figure is up 3.7% on the previous year and up 58.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, meat of camels, fresh or chilled (indigenous) — gross production value in Asia peaked at 810,155 1000 Int$ in 2024 and was at its lowest, 189,566 1000 Int$, in 1961.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
